[Xapian-tickets] [Xapian] #764: qp_scale1 intermittently fails on 64-core POWER9 workstation

Xapian nobody at xapian.org
Wed Jan 22 22:50:18 GMT 2020


#764: qp_scale1 intermittently fails on 64-core POWER9 workstation
------------------------+-------------------------------
 Reporter:  A. Wilcox   |             Owner:  Olly Betts
     Type:  defect      |            Status:  new
 Priority:  normal      |         Milestone:
Component:  Test Suite  |           Version:  1.4.6
 Severity:  normal      |        Resolution:
 Keywords:              |        Blocked By:
 Blocking:              |  Operating System:  Linux
------------------------+-------------------------------
Comment (by Olly Betts):

 I've made some changes which may improve this, though for me it only fails
 very very rarely so I can't be very sure.  These should be in 1.4.15 (once
 it is release):

 * 626bb0058fdcee9a30e667ebde1ae4ca66e8ff39 (cherry picked from commit
 c30ec9a6ca9f1a91e0d7c160cabf280c3b1c5299)
 * 399d143dd6a32913c81f782e968ba0640474232d (cherry picked from commit
 f8383842183b6af604f7f066a9538754d9b263af)
 * 15a48e06de22a8a23a6a2bf26d84e1329fcd595d (cherry picked from commit
 d94be50772672c7bfbe120a0af7d10feb331ea42)
 * 1e80e20039cd2841a2d40079e06aba21d8aa99a7 (cherry picked from commit
 a171ad53225e7aaa079b0aef80790f2a24e08c44)

 Feedback on whether these changes help would be useful.

 If this testcase remains a bit flaky perhaps we should change it to test
 the scaling behaviour for the current "large" case as the number of
 repeated copies of the input query string grows (which is more like how
 our other scaling testcases work) - currently it compares parsing one copy
 N*M times with parsing N copies M times.
-- 
Ticket URL: <https://trac.xapian.org/ticket/764#comment:3>
Xapian <https://xapian.org/>
Xapian


More information about the Xapian-tickets mailing list